Dhaka, Dec. 29 -- Vietjet, Vietnam's budget airline, is set to close 2025 with its largest-ever fleet expansion, taking delivery of 22 new aircraft before year's end.
The airline received an Airbus A321neo ACF (VN-A580) this Christmas, marking a significant milestone in its history.
The new aircraft have been distributed across Vietjet's operations: nine Boeing jets for Vietjet Thailand, seven next-gen Airbus planes for its Vietnam fleet, four wet-lease aircraft for peak travel periods, and two COMAC aircraft for routes to Con Dao."
The expansion comes ahead of the 2026 Lunar New Year, a peak travel period, and will support growing demand both domestically and internationally.
